What are the current code requirements for a roof replacement in Lake County?

All work requires a permit from Lake County Planning, Building and Development and must be performed by a contractor licensed by the Illinois Department of Financial and Professional Regulation. The 2021 IRC, with state amendments, now mandates specific ice and water shield application in eaves and valleys, and upgraded flashing details. These code-minimums are designed for basic performance; the IBHS FORTIFIED standard we recommend adopts even stricter requirements for attachment and sealing.

Could my roof problems actually be caused by poor attic ventilation?

Absolutely. On a 4/12 pitch roof common here, improper ventilation traps superheated air in the attic. This bakes the shingles from below, shortening their life, and causes moisture condensation that leads to attic mold and decking rot. The 2021 IRC with Illinois amendments specifies a balanced system of soffit intake and ridge exhaust; achieving this balance is non-negotiable for roof longevity and indoor air quality in our climate.

What roof upgrades make sense for our wind and hail risks?

Forest Lake's 115 mph wind zone mandates a focus on sealed roof deck attachment and high-wind rated shingles. For the moderate hail risk, specifying shingles with a UL 2218 Class 4 impact rating is a financial necessity ahead of the April-June peak storm season. These shingles resist damage from 1.25-inch hailstones, drastically reducing the frequency of insurance claims. This combination directly protects your home's structure and moderates long-term insurance costs.
